#7e998f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e998f is composed of 49.4% red, 60%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.5%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 157.8 degrees, a saturation of 11.7% and a lightness of 54.7%. #7e998f color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ffff with #00331f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#7e998f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e998f has RGB values of R:126, G:153,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 8296847.

Shades and Tints of #7e998f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f6f8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e998f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#87908d is the less saturated color, while #1cfba8 is the most saturated one.
